HTTP POST with some Params in URL and others in application/x-www-form-urlencoded Body

success := false
// This example requires the Chilkat API to have been previously unlocked.
// See Global Unlock Sample for sample code.
// Imagine a URL that contains two params: one named "xyz" and one named "name".
// We want to send a POST to it, but with 2 additional params in the body of the request.
url := "http://www.chilkatsoft.com/echoPost.asp?xyz=123&name=matt"
http := chilkat.NewHttp()
// Provide a session log path so we can visually verify the exact request sent.
// (This is only for debugging purposes.)
http.SetSessionLogFilename("c:/temp/httpLog.txt")
// Create an HTTP request that has two additional params
req := chilkat.NewHttpRequest()
req.SetHttpVerb("POST")
req.SetPath("/echoPost.asp?xyz=123&name=matt")
req.AddParam("sport","tennis")
req.AddParam("tournament","French Open")
// Send the HTTP POST and get the response.
resp := chilkat.NewHttpResponse()
success = http.HttpSReq("www.chilkatsoft.com",80,false,req,resp)
if success == false {
fmt.Println(http.LastErrorText())
http.DisposeHttp()
req.DisposeHttpRequest()
resp.DisposeHttpResponse()
return
}
fmt.Println(resp.BodyStr())
fmt.Println("Success.")
http.DisposeHttp()
req.DisposeHttpRequest()
resp.DisposeHttpResponse()
